Cameroon - Import of Fresh or Chilled Fish Fillet or Meat

Since 2014, Cameroon Import of Fresh or Chilled Fish Fillet or Meat decreased by 10.3% year on year. With $6,283.04 in 2019, the country was ranked number 143 among other countries in Import of Fresh or Chilled Fish Fillet or Meat. Cameroon is overtaken by Senegal, which was number 142 at $9,177.06 and is followed by Solomon Islands at $5,368.1. United States topped the ranking with $2,707,911,682.15 in 2019, an increase of 1.8% versus 2018. France, Germany and Sweden resp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Pakistan witnessed the best average annual growth at +259.6% per year, while Yemen was the worst growing country at -62.2% per year.
